Transaction 51e9833e286e1d45ed060cbd31b737b96460ff4475fc8ae4d21a06aca93bb19c
1 Input
1 Output
-
51e9833e286e1d45ed060cbd31b737b96460ff4475fc8ae4d21a06aca93bb19c:0
- value
- 10403047
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9b16fa36e83b8df29167380a6f0f280bfa744982 OP_EQUAL
- address
- 3Fq4Bmv8bXdv2sqWgmmK7SnfYT6YjeWvbv